ScubaLab Imaging Roundup

For the special photo-themed issue of Scuba Diving magazine, ScubaLab reviewed new underwater imaging equipment. Instead of our typical head-to-head reviews testing one type of product, the following highlights several different categories of imaging gear, including cameras, underwater smartphone housings, strobes, video lights, wet lenses and other accessories.

Camera Kits

ikelite Deluxe Underwater Housing Kit with Tough TG-7 and Ecko Fiber Strobe

This kit combines the small but mighty OM System Tough TG-7 camera with an extremely lightweight Ikelite housing and a simple-to-use fiber-optic Ecko Fiber strobe. The TG-7offers point-and-shoot simplicity as well as advanced image control. It has a 25-100mm midrange zoom lens and a special microscope mode that makes for incredible macro imaging. It is waterproof on its own to 50 feet (15 meters). Inside the Ikelite housing it has a depth rating of 200 feet (60 meters). The housing is constructed of a specially formulated ABS-PC and features a light color to keep equipment cooler in warm, sunny environments. It provides access to all the camera’s functions and is compatible with a variety of lenses and ports for increased flexibility.

The compact, powerful fiber-optic strobe features TTL functionality to automatically adjust output based on the distance of the subject for effortless exposure control. It also includes several manual set points. The package includes a single handle tray and adjustable ball arm for a sleek, travel-ready setup that is suitable for divers of any experience level.

This sleek smartphone housing doesn’t require batteries, a specialized app, a wireless connection or even buttons. It provides full touchscreen control for minimal complexity and maximum versatility. Users can operate their smartphone just like they would on land, allowing them to capture, review, edit and share media directly from their phone using their favorite apps without needing to remove the phone from the housing.

The housing is depth-rated to 196 feet (60 meters) and accommodates a wide variety of smartphone models. The Ocean Kit pictured here includes an accessory bracket with an M67 thread expansion clamp, 0.6x underwater wide-angle conversion lens, red filter, protective cover and travel case. An optional wireless shutter release is available for users who prefer the ergonomics of a traditional camera’s shutter operation.

This Bluetooth-enabled, vacuum-sealed smartphone housing is compatible with both Android and iPhone models. The corrosion-resistant heavy-duty aluminum housing is depth-rated to depths of 280 feet. The housing is powered by a rechargeable, replaceable 18650 battery, which can also be utilized to charge the user’s smartphone while it is installed inside. It is compatible with standard camera trays and can be equipped with an accessory wet lens using an optional adjustable mounting bracket.

Kraken’s new NextGen app provides advanced imaging functionality and dive tracking capabilities. Post dive, users can access AI-powered editing tools via the app to enhance and color-correct images. The pro version of the housing includes a depth and temperature sensor, which allows the app to provide real-time dive data and record dive logs.

This multifunction fiber-optic strobe is suited to both photography and videography. It boasts impressive performance whether used as an underwater flash or a video light and includes a tantalizing list of advanced features. The powerful strobe boasts an f/40 guide number, and the video light outputs a max of 5,000 lumens. Video lighting modes include spot, wide and red light, plus two emergency signaling modes. Users can adjust the angle of coverage and color temperature by using optional diffusers and filters—a flat diffuser is included.

When combined with Backscatter’s Smart Control TTL (sold separately), the light offers seamless, automatic TTL exposure control for Sony, Olympus and OM System cameras. Manual exposure control is also available. It is compatible with high-speed sync and wireless off-camera remote control. It is powered by two 21700 lithium-ion batteries. These powerful, rugged strobes are constructed with an aluminum body depth-rated to 330 feet (100 meters). They are available with either 40, 80 or 160 watt-seconds of power to suit a variety of photography needs. Fiber-optic sync allows compatibility with a wide range of cameras and Kraken’s fiberoptic remote-control system. The KR-S160 also supports electronic sync for additional flexibility. The strobes’ flash tube provides soft, even lighting with a 5,500K color temperature, and they include a small aiming light to assist during focusing. Rear-mounted dials offer easy, accessible control.

The KR-S160 has a rotatable OLED display that indicates mode and flashes remaining at the current level, and the KR-S80 has an LCD display. The strobes utilize rechargeable, replaceable lithium-ion batteries to ensure users can always swap out to a fully charged battery between dives. Strobes include two diffusers, and a full suite of optional snoots, diffusers and other accessories are available.

Offering a max output of 5,600 lumens and a wide 120-degree beam angle, this underwater video light is perfectly suited for smartphone housings, action cameras and other compact video rigs. It features nine power settings to optimize output and battery life—it will run for 34 minutes at max power and 200 minutes on low. The large variation in power settings makes the light very versatile, as it can also act as a focus light or primary dive light.

The light uses an intuitive two-button operation and has an LCD power indicator display. The anodized aircraft-grade aluminum body is corrosion-resistant and depth-rated to 328 feet (100 meters). The light includes an M6-thread ball mount and a rechargeable lithium-ion battery pack.

This line of high-power professional-grade underwater video lights ranges from 3,000 to 18,000-lumen models. In addition to a 100-degree floodlight that can illuminate even the darkest underwater scenes, these lights include red, green and blue LEDs that can be mixed in varying amounts to produce a wide range of colors—including ultraviolet light for capturing fluorescence. Lights can be fired in burst mode for use in still photography.

A fiber-optic port enables them to be synced to a camera or triggered via a remote strobe (Hydra 3000 does not have remote capability). Lights can also be operated using Kraken’s optional remote control. This accessory allows users to adjust settings for brightness, cycle between operating modes and enable or disable standby mode. Lights can be controlled individually or simultaneously.

Designed with a special donut-shaped COB LED array, this compact, feature-rich video light emits both its wide and spotlight beams from a single source to ensure optimal lighting with natural-looking shadows whether shooting wide-angle or macro. The light outputs a max of 4,000 lumens, with four preset power levels—it also has two hidden emergency signal modes. Users can further finetune the brightness in 1 percent increments from zero to 100. A memory function saves the user-set intensity to retain the setting after the light is turned off.

The intuitive three-button operation is complemented by a large LCD display that shows the current power level and the remaining battery life in minutes. The light can be used in combination with still photography strobes, as it will temporarily turn off when a flash is detected.

The latest and largest of Kraken’s self-contained underwater external monitors, this new version is powered by twin 21700 batteries—the same used in many of the brand’s dive torches and imaging lights. The brilliantly bright, crystal-clear 7-inch display makes it easy to frame wide-angle shots and closely inspect macro composition in all conditions, even in bright sun. Operation is intuitive and includes four programmable function buttons for quickly accessing waveforms, histograms, zebra exposure, grid view, focus assist and other critical info. The screen maxes out at an impressive 2,200 nits of brightness, with a huge range of adjustment.

The 4K HDMI signal input and output are compatible with M24 and M16 bulkheads. The monitor includes a fully articulating ball mount for easy positioning and ready compatibility with any camera rig. Included batteries feature integrated USB-C charging ports and will power the monitor for up to 140 minutes at 100 percent brightness. It is depth-rated to 226 feet (80 meters).

This kit combines a unique wet-lens mounting system designed specifically for GoPro cameras with a professional-grade wide-angle lens that offers a super-wide 140-degree view underwater and a 4-inch minimum focus distance. Compatible with the GoPro Protector housing for Hero 9, 10, 11, 12 and 13 cameras, the compact frame snaps onto the housing’s lens port and connects to the housing’s bottom attachment point. The frame’s QRS-2 bayonet system makes for quick, easy installation and removal of the included lens—and any other compatible QRS-2 lens, such as the +15 MacroMate Mini with an adapter.

A special slot allows users to install color filters behind the wet lens—the included Dive+ and Deep+ red filters cover depths of 20 to 45 feet and 45 to 80 feet, respectively. The lens offers razor-sharp focus from corner to corner. Its super-wide viewing angle combined with its short minimum focal distance allows for dramatic close-up, wide-angle images. It is depth-rated to 200 feet (60 meters).

The latest version of the Super Macro Converter is two-thirds the weight of the original while retaining the same high-quality clarity and precision. When combined with a full-frame camera and a 100mm or 105mm macro lens, it provides up to a 2.4x magnification factor and a working distance of approximately 51 to 103 millimeters. The lens is constructed using specially formulated low-dispersion optical-grade glass with a broadband anti-reflective coating to reduce common optical issues such as chromatic aberrations and field deformation.

The SMC-3 was crafted using a specially developed algorithm to optimize high-resolution image quality over the full focusing range of the lens. The converter increases brightness and contrast of the image, further aiding the speed and effectiveness of autofocus systems within this range. The optics feature a hard anodized aluminum housing depth-rated to 330 feet (100 meters), with an M67 thread diameter. Nitrogen purging during assembly eliminates fogging.
